The signs many men notice
Low testosterone rarely announces itself. It usually shows up as a slow slide that is easy to blame on age or stress. A licensed review, with lab work where needed, is what tells whether low testosterone is behind it.
- Flat energy and fatigue that sleep does not fix
- Lower drive and interest, in and out of the bedroom
- Harder time holding muscle or making gym progress
- Mood, focus and motivation that feel dialed down
Any one of these can have other causes, which is the whole point of the online review: it separates low testosterone from everything else before anything is prescribed.

What the routine looks like
Most men start on a modest dose and settle into a simple, regular routine, often a small weekly dose managed at home once the licensed service shows you how. Some men use other prescribed forms instead. The point is a steady schedule that keeps levels even.
Early on, the plan is deliberately careful. Doses are kept sensible, follow-up is built in, and check-ins, including any repeat lab work, help fine tune things as your body responds, wherever you are in Arkansas.
It is a medical routine, not a quick fix, and it is not right for everyone. That is precisely why the online review, and lab work where needed, come first. Results vary, and the medications used in some online programs are compounded, prepared by licensed US pharmacies.
